45 figs and 15 vehicles planned for next year.

NO Flagg or Terrordrome planned.

samjjones
08-14-2009, 02:51 PM
ROC Hiss (new design)
Arctic Threat Duke
Arctic Threat Snow Job
Arctic Threat Destro
Arctic Threat Snake Eyes
Jungle Assault Storm Shadow (uses Resolute body)
Jungle Assault Duke
Jungle Assault Cobra Commander
Jungle Assault Viper
Jungle Assault Recondo
Desert Battle Zartan
Desert Battle Ripcord
Desert Battle Heavy Duty
City Strike Scarlett (uses Resolute body)
City Strike Firefly
Cobra Ice Cutter w/ Snow Serpent Officer
Sand Serpent w/ Star Viper (Raven repaint)
Cobra Commander mailaway

Guardian
08-14-2009, 04:00 PM
i know, tell me about it, i want to know how much they cost at the con too.

Blades w/ SAF Gyrocopter: $28.00
JUMP 2-Pack w/ Starduster and Manleh: $45.00
3-Pack w/ Sgt. Shimik, Sgt. Redmack, and Sgt. Topson: $65.00
Crimson Command Copter: $30.00
Joe or COBRA Weapon Set: $8.00
12″ Crimson Guard: $50.00
